Symptoms

  • •Temperature gauge remains at maximum reading
  • •Engine warning light illuminated
  • •Steam or coolant leaks observed from the engine bay
  • •Reduced engine performance or power loss
  • •Unusual smells (burning or coolant odor)

Solution
1. Preparation
  • Gather the necessary tools and parts.
  • Ensure the vehicle is parked on a level surface and the engine is cool.
  • Disconnect the battery to prevent electrical shorts.
2. Check and Replace Coolant
  • Step 1: Remove the radiator cap carefully to avoid pressure release.
  • Step 2: If the coolant level is low, add the appropriate type of coolant (check owner’s manual for specifications).
  • Step 3: Replace the radiator cap securely.
3. Replace Coolant Temperature Sensor
  • Step 1: Locate the coolant temperature sensor (usually near the thermostat housing).
  • Step 2: Disconnect the electrical connector from the sensor.
  • Step 3: Remove the old sensor using a socket wrench.
  • Step 4: Apply Teflon tape to the threads of the new sensor to prevent leaks.
  • Step 5: Install the new sensor and reconnect the electrical connector.
4. Test Cooling System
  • Step 1: Refill the coolant system if necessary.
  • Step 2: Reconnect the battery and start the engine.
  • Step 3: Monitor the temperature gauge while the engine warms up to ensure it operates within normal range.
